Description

A kind of double back cable suitable for built span line draws lower facility
【Technical field】
The present invention relates to ultra-high-tension power transmission line technical fields, especially a kind of double back cable suitable for built span line Draw lower facility.
【Background technology】
With China's rapid economic development, overhead transmission line, high-speed railway, highway etc. are largely built with surprising rapidity If being limited by factors such as landform, traffic, distance, densely populated place degree, the friendships such as overhead transmission line and high-speed railway, highway It is very universal to pitch situation.For the overhead transmission line across facilities such as high-speed railway, highways, newly-built, fortune inspection can with transformation Under the influence of square iron road and highway safety, to ensure safety, traffic department even can will temporarily stoppage in transit railway and highway, influence huge Greatly.
For needing the engineering in built double-circuit line across under drawing in shelves, traditional scheme by cable draw lower point be transferred to across More outside shelves, while paying attention to control and crossing at a distance from the anchor support of shelves both sides, anchor support is avoided to exceed because unbalanced tensile force changes Use scope, but the distance of cable laying laying can be significantly increased, lead to construction cost, building time, civil coordination.
Therefore, it is necessary to propose that a kind of double back cable suitable for built span line draws lower facility, built circuit is utilized Across the anchor support of shelves both sides, reduces cable and draw the lower influence to span line.
【Invention content】
The main purpose of the present invention is to provide a kind of double back cables suitable for built span line to draw lower facility, is suitble to Under in built line crossing shelves both sides, anchor support draws, avoid leads to unnecessary cable laying because cable draws lower position.
To achieve the above object, the technical solution that the present invention takes is:
A kind of double back cable suitable for built span line draws lower facility, it includes shaft, upper layer cross-arm, middle level cross Load, lower layer's cross-arm, pillar arrester, cable termination and cable;
The upper layer cross-arm is located at the top of shaft, and both sides cross-arm is arranged in parallel circuit direction, and branch is arranged in cross-arm ending Column arrester arranges both sides cross-arm in 60 degree of angles counterclockwise with line direction, cable termination is arranged in cross-arm ending;
The middle level cross-arm is located at below the cross-arm of upper layer, and both sides cross-arm is arranged in parallel circuit direction, is arranged in cross-arm ending Cable termination is arranged both sides cross-arm in 60 degree of angles clockwise with line direction, pillar arrester is arranged in cross-arm ending;
Lower layer's cross-arm is located at below the cross-arm of middle level, and both sides cross-arm is arranged in 60 degree of angles counterclockwise with line direction, in Pillar arrester is arranged in cross-arm ending, and both sides cross-arm is arranged in 60 degree of angles clockwise with line direction, electricity is arranged in cross-arm ending Cable terminal.
Compared with prior art, beneficial effects of the present invention:1) it is suitble to be close to built line crossing shelves anchor support construction;2) Shaft tower construction is small to built line influence;2) double-loop T connection can be achieved, cut-off and the multiple functions such as reconfiguration;3) with newly-built straight line, Anchor support is compared, and construction cost is greatly reduced, and reduces floor space.

【Specific implementation mode】
To make the technical means, the creative features, the aims and the efficiencies achieved by the present invention be easy to understand, with reference to Specific implementation mode, the present invention is further explained.
As shown in Figs. 1-2, a kind of double back cable suitable for built span line draws lower facility, it includes shaft 1, upper layer Cross-arm 2, middle level cross-arm 3, lower layer's cross-arm 4, pillar arrester 5, cable termination 6 and cable 7.
The upper layer cross-arm 2 is located at the top of shaft 1, and both sides cross-arm is arranged in parallel circuit direction, is arranged in cross-arm ending Pillar arrester 5 arranges both sides cross-arm in 60 degree of angles counterclockwise with line direction, cable termination 6 is arranged in cross-arm ending.
The middle level cross-arm 3 is located at below the cross-arm of upper layer, and both sides cross-arm is arranged in parallel circuit direction, is arranged in cross-arm ending Both sides cross-arm is arranged in 60 degree of angles clockwise with line direction in cable termination 6, in cross-arm ending setting pillar arrester 5.
Lower layer's cross-arm 4 is located at below the cross-arm of middle level, and both sides cross-arm is arranged in 60 degree of angles counterclockwise with line direction, in Pillar arrester 5 is arranged in cross-arm ending, and both sides cross-arm is arranged in 60 degree of angles clockwise with line direction, electricity is arranged in cross-arm ending Cable terminal 6.
5 place cross-arm of the pillar arrester is in 60 degree of angles, and 6 place cross-arm of cable termination is in 60 degree of angles, it is ensured that cable is whole The cable of 6 lower section of end is not in same vertical plane.
The overhead transmission line using wire jumper by the conducting wire at anchor support be connected to the adjacent pillar arrester 5 of same layer cross-arm with Cable termination 6 forms cable and is located at below 6 place cross-arm of cable termination, arranged along shaft 1, under realizing that cable draws.
The cross-arm that cable termination 6 is fixed in the upper layer cross-arm 2, middle level cross-arm 3, lower layer's cross-arm 4 is in mutually 60 degree and does not exist Same vertical plane does not fix the cross-arm of pillar arrester 5 in the upper layer cross-arm 2, middle level cross-arm 3, lower layer's cross-arm 4 mutually in 60 degree and not Same vertical plane again ensures power cable at a distance from live part when being under cable draws.
Same layer cross-arm is arranged in " X ", is conducive to cross-arm fixation on shaft 1 and is easily installed, it is advantageously ensured that cross-arm is slightly Electrical distance between bilge cod arrester 5, cable termination 6, shaft 1, is conducive to be effectively compressed whole height.
The upper layer cross-arm 2, middle level cross-arm 3, the length of lower layer's cross-arm 4 and spacing need to meet electric clearance, lightning protection Requirement;Existing line conducting wire is satisfied by the requirement of electric clearance, lightning protection with the cross-arm.
Embodiment 1
For with built line crossing shelves strain insulator steel tower cooperation T connect draw under in the case of, as shown in Figure 1, being close to double loop Cable draws lower facility at line tension tower 7 newly-built one, topping wire be respectively connected to the A seating arrester 5 of 2 taper of upper layer cross-arm with At cable termination 6, vertical plane of the switching at cable along 6 place cross-arm of cable terminal introduces underground, during middle layer conductor is respectively connected to The A seating arrester 5 of layer 3 taper of cross-arm draws with the vertical plane at cable along 6 place cross-arm of cable terminal of at cable termination 6, transferring Enter underground;Lower layer conductor is respectively connected to the A seating arrester 5 of 4 taper of lower layer's cross-arm at cable termination 6, and switching is at cable along electricity The vertical plane of 6 place cross-arm of cable cable terminal introduces underground.
Embodiment 2
For with built line crossing shelves strain insulator steel tower cooperation cut-off draw under in the case of, in built line crossing shelves strain insulator iron Tower both sides create cable at one and draw lower facility respectively, and it is same as Example 1 that cable draws the lower facility mode of connection, while will be existing resistance to The wire jumper for opening tower is all unlocked.
